The first season of The Rookie premiered on ABC in 2018, marking a successful career pivot for Nathan Fillion. It follows John Nolan, a 45-year-old divorcee who moves to Los Angeles to become the oldest rookie in the LAPD. 📋 Season Overview Episodes: 20 Network: ABC Genre: Police Procedural / Drama Main Setting: Mid-Wilshire Division, Los Angeles
Core Theme: Second chances and the reality of modern policing. 🎭 Main Characters & Dynamics
The season focuses on three rookie-T.O. (Training Officer) pairings: the rookie season 1 complete pack new
John Nolan & Talia Bishop: Nolan struggles with physical age and skepticism from leadership. Bishop is ambitious and plays strictly by the book.
Lucy Chen & Tim Bradford: Bradford is "old school" and puts Chen through grueling tests to ensure she can survive the streets.
Jackson West & Angela Lopez: West is a legacy hire (son of Internal Affairs) who suffers from "stage fright" during shootouts. Lopez is a tough-love mentor. 📈 Major Plot Arcs The "Mid-Life" Struggle
John Nolan must prove he isn't just having a mid-life crisis. He faces constant scrutiny from Sergeant Wade Grey, who views Nolan as a walking liability. Internal Relationships
A major Season 1 subplot involves a secret romance between Nolan and Lucy Chen. They eventually end it to protect their careers, as "rookie dating" is highly stigmatized. High-Stakes Episodes
The Switch: A massive manhunt following a prisoner transport crash.
Greenlight: A devastating episode where the team faces a deadly threat from a white supremacist gang, resulting in the death of a major character.
Free Fall (Finale): An isolated bio-terror threat locks down the city and puts the rookies' training to the ultimate test. 🛠️ "The Complete Pack" Features

The Rookie Season 1 Complete Pack (specifically the DVD Complete First Season) offers a comprehensive look at the high-stakes world of the LAPD through the eyes of its oldest recruit, John Nolan (Nathan Fillion). The Foundation of a Late-Life Pivot
At its core, Season 1 is a study of human resilience and the "midlife crisis" redefined as a midlife calling. After a life-altering bank robbery in Pennsylvania, 40-year-old John Nolan moves to Los Angeles to become the oldest rookie in the history of the LAPD. The "Complete Pack" captures this entire 20-episode arc, highlighting the skepticism Nolan faces from Sergeant Wade Grey and the physical and mental hurdles he must overcome to keep pace with his younger counterparts. Technical and Physical Specifications
The physical pack is designed for collectors and long-form viewers who prefer high-quality physical media over streaming bitrates.
Format and Discs: The set typically consists of 4 discs containing approximately 14 hours of content.
Visuals and Audio: It features an anamorphic 1.78:1 aspect ratio with Dolby Digital 5.1 English audio.
Subtitles: Options generally include English SDH, French, and Spanish, making it accessible to a wider audience. Content Highlights
The pack includes all 20 episodes of the debut season, which established the show's signature blend of intense action and character-driven humor. Notable milestones include:
The Pilot: Establishing Nolan's outsider status and his initial pairing with Training Officer Talia Bishop.
Plain Clothes Day: A fan-favorite episode (S1, E14) where rookies must make all decisions while their TOs remain out of uniform and silent.
The Greenlight: An emotional high point (S1, E16) that shifts the series' stakes and demonstrates the inherent dangers of the job. Why the "Complete Pack" Matters
While The Rookie is available on various streaming platforms, the complete season pack serves as a "solid" investment for those valuing permanency and the ability to binge the origin stories of now-beloved characters like Lucy Chen and Tim Bradford without worrying about licensing changes. It encapsulates a time when the show was more grounded in the "fish out of water" procedural format before expanding into the broader ensemble drama it is today.
